About Cornerstone IGA

Cornerstone IGA is a community-focused independent grocery retailer operating as part of the IGA (Independent Grocers Alliance) network. As a full-service supermarket, the store provides a comprehensive range of goods, including fresh produce, meat, dairy, bakery items, and pantry staples, alongside essential household supplies.

Unlike national corporate chains, Cornerstone IGA functions as a locally owned and operated business, tailored to the specific needs of its immediate neighborhood. Its defining characteristic is its commitment to the "hometown grocer" model, which emphasizes personalized customer service and a localized supply chain that often prioritizes regional products, distinguishing it from the standardized inventory found in large-scale supermarket conglomerates.
